Transaction 8294544e8fc3ebac54d4997ac3152ab23158f2a2501e2c820007fb4f29132698
1 Input
1 Output
-
8294544e8fc3ebac54d4997ac3152ab23158f2a2501e2c820007fb4f29132698:0
- value
- 30659
- script pubkey
- OP_0 OP_PUSHBYTES_20 53f2904c1b2ddca232e0f9218d1a4b4af9526354
- address
- bc1q20efqnqm9hw2yvhqlysc6xjtftu4yc65ya6z2q